Transaction daa00820cc5c3a3431e18d720c0b2961ba575a15217ef93dede04ce28197ca94
1 Input
2 Outputs
- daa00820cc5c3a3431e18d720c0b2961ba575a15217ef93dede04ce28197ca94:0
- daa00820cc5c3a3431e18d720c0b2961ba575a15217ef93dede04ce28197ca94:1
value 1432816
address 3BLKyx9pdBsXiiWkZNN6jtFAdsobmrKNDQ
value 42389945
address 19ir3ZkQAWCLcmubNfKC89jtr7SA3hhyWY